Hong Kong Tech Delegation to Showcase Innovations at MWC 2026 and 4YFN

The Hong Kong Trade Development Council (HKTDC), in collaboration with Hong Kong Science and Technology Parks Corporation (HKSTP), is leading a delegation of 21 Hong Kong tech companies and institutions to showcase at Mobile World Congress (MWC) 2026 and debut at 4 Years From Now (4YFN) 2026, taking place concurrently from 2-5 March in Barcelona, Spain. This dual presence at world-class tech exhibitions underscores Hong Kong’s ambition to position itself as an international innovation and technology (I&T) hub.

Building on the momentum from MWC 2025, the Hong Kong Tech Pavilion will feature solutions beyond connectivity, covering Devices and Systems, Digital Transformation, and support from Ecosystem Partners. The pavilion aims to provide a comprehensive picture of Hong Kong’s I&T capabilities, engaging global telecom leaders, enterprise decision-makers, industry partners, and investors. The initiative bridges cutting-edge research and development into real-world applications, propelling Hong Kong’s I&T sector onto the international stage.

A series of dialogues and exchanges, including networking receptions, themed talks, and pitching sessions, will take place at the Pavilion to facilitate partnerships and investment opportunities for market-ready innovative solutions with high potential for expansion. Notable exhibitors include Asmote and Cresento. Asmote, located at MWC, specialises in mmWave technology for Integrated Sensing and Communication (ISAC), particularly for drone communications and control, supporting the city’s low-altitude economy initiatives. The company previously secured the world’s first 26GHz mmWave 5G commercial communications project. Cresento, at 4YFN, focuses on an AI-powered shin guard that provides real-time performance analytics for football players, moving from prototypes to pilot collaborations with European football clubs and academies.
